I’m uh...curious about your reasoning behind all these
OK.
Dexter's Laboratory/The Flash: Barry is a forensic scientist and his powers came from a lab accident. He's one smart cookie.

Johnny Bravo/Wonder Woman: Cause Johnny is always stalking women

Powerpuff Girls/Super Sons: Cause there already was a Powerpuff Girls/Teen Titans crossover in Teen Titans Go and Super Sons is a more prominent new team of younger heroes. Plus 3 and 2 is a much better number for a team up then 3 and 5.

Ed, Edd n Eddy/Batman: Batman's the world's greatest detective and Eddy is the world's greatest con artist.

Courage the Cowardly Dog: John Constantine: OK. Do I really need to explain this one?

Samurai Jack/Booster Gold: Jack is a samurai trapped in the future, Booster does time travel all the time.

Codename: Kids Next Door/Suicide Squad: Two teams of off the books paramilitary squads with eccentric weaponry who go on secret missions.

The Grim Adventures of Billy and Mandy/Etrigan the Demon: A demon bound to two mortals and a mortal bound to a demon.

Evil Con Carne/Legion of Doom: Con Carne is all about poking fun at supervillain tropes so put him with DC's team of supervillains.

Foster's Home for Imaginary Friends/Sandman: Sandman is the lord of dreams, Imaginary Friends are MADE of dreams.

Ben 10/Shazam: Kids who gain the ability to turn into superpowerd heroes. Ben has 10 aliens, Shazam gets the power of 6 gods.

Chowder/Matter-Eater Lad: The only DC hero who has anything to do with eating and is also considered a joke by many, perfect for a show as humor-centric as Chowder.

Generator Rex/Blue Beetle: Hispanic teenagers with the power to form weapons from their bodies.

Adventure Time/Kamandi: The stories of two kids who are the last human alive in a post apocalyptic world of strange anthropomorphic creatures (food for AT and animals for Kamandi) in their respective universes.

Regular Show/Darkseid: Accidentally discovering the Anti-Life Equation and having to fight Darkseid is totally in line with the kinds of things that happen to Mordecai and Rigby.

Steven Universe/Green Lantern: Magical multicolored rocks from outer space powered by emotions.
